Pros Cons Honda CB350

Pros

  • This Honda engine delivers strong low-end torque and a smooth power delivery.
  • Its upright riding position and relaxed seat height make the CB350 easy to ride.
  • It displays strong build quality and premium feel as expected of a Honda.
  • It feels stable at highway cruising speeds, which makes it great for long rides. 
  • The light controls and neutral handling make it ideal for inexperienced riders, too. 

Cons

  • The rider will need to change gears frequently in slow-moving traffic.
  • The CB350’s headlight is average and could have been better for night riding. 
  • It can feel heavy while performing tight turns at slow speeds. 
  • Buyers may find the BigWing sales and service network to be limited.
  • The suspension setup feels hard when ridden over broken roads.

Verdict

The Honda CB350 is a well-rounded retro motorcycle that has a very interesting combination of classic styling that’s skillfully united with refinement, reliability, and everyday usability. Agreed it may not be among the most charming motorcycles in its segment, but where it excels is at delivering a smooth riding experience, comfortable ergonomics, and fuss-free ownership.

If you are looking to buy a retro motorcycle that is comfortable, refined, and easy to live with every day, the CB350 is the one to opt for. However, if widespread service accessibility, stronger emotional appeal, or a more characterful riding experience are more important, then some of its rivals can prove more appealing.
